Transaction 383779908061d16dd5f1949a5637c3a67ab01c255fb7e408fea9202de165932a
1 Input
2 Outputs
- 383779908061d16dd5f1949a5637c3a67ab01c255fb7e408fea9202de165932a:0
- 383779908061d16dd5f1949a5637c3a67ab01c255fb7e408fea9202de165932a:1
value 50556
address 192XRu63uEDh8fWqn982z7nGspQiDmE78w
value 78195
address 3EpUQjPqjnm9N5QyiAuNvchuzd9nehNukQ